Undifferentiated Connective Tissue Disease: Comprehensive Review

Undifferentiated connective tissue disease (UCTD) often evolves into specific autoimmune conditions like SLE, but many patients experience remission. This mild autoimmune disease has good survival rates, though quality of life data is lacking.
Area of Science:
- Rheumatology
- Immunology
- Systemic Autoimmune Diseases
Background:
- Undifferentiated connective tissue disease (UCTD) presents with autoimmune symptoms but doesn't meet criteria for established diseases.
- Debate exists whether UCTD is distinct or an early phase of diseases like systemic lupus erythematosus (SLE) or scleroderma.
Approach:
- Systematic review of six published UCTD cohorts.
- Analysis of disease evolution, treatment, and outcomes.
Key Points:
- 28% of UCTD patients evolve into definable syndromes (e.g., SLE, rheumatoid arthritis) within 5-6 years.
- 18% achieve remission; treatments include low-dose prednisone, hydroxychloroquine, NSAIDs, and sometimes immunosuppressants.
- Survival rates exceed 90% over 10 years, but patient-reported outcomes and quality of life data are limited.
Conclusions:
- UCTD is a generally mild autoimmune condition with favorable survival.
- Uncertainty in diagnosis and management persists.
- Standardized classification criteria are crucial for advancing UCTD research and clinical guidance.
